Cooperative Path Planning Method for Enhancing Ground-Units Survivability Based on Adaptive Q-Learning

摘要

In this paper, a modified Q-Learning cooperative path planning method for enhancing the survivability of multiple ground units is proposed to alleviate the high time-consuming problem caused by wide-area road network environment and threats. The road network is established as a weighted undirected graph model based on the connection relationship of the road network nodes firstly. Then, by changing the division of the state space and the action space of the traditional Q-learning algorithm, an adaptive Q-learning algorithm based on the road network graph is proposed. The action space of the adaptive Q-learning is determined through the graph topology, and an incentive function considering threat information and target distance is designed. Further more, the adaptive Q table assessment mechanism is customized to realize the effective adaptation of complex road network scenario with single training model, whose state input is the relative start-goal distance. Finally, numerical simulations have verified the effectiveness of the proposed algorithm. Compared with sparse A* algorithm, with the increase of the scale of ground units, the planning time of the algorithm proposed is significantly reduced under the condition that the total path cost is roughly equal. Taking four and six ground units cooperative path planning for example, the average planning time of the proposed algorithm is 0.038 s and 0.041 s, which is 76.48% and 83.25% lower than the sparse A* algorithm, which verifies the efficiency and engineering practicability.
